log

package
v1.13.7 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 14, 2023 License: Apache-2.0 Imports: 14 Imported by: 17

Documentation

Index

Constants

This section is empty.

Variables

View Source
var (
	TraceLevel = zerolog.TraceLevel
	DebugLevel = zerolog.DebugLevel
	InfoLevel  = zerolog.InfoLevel
	WarnLevel  = zerolog.WarnLevel
	ErrorLevel = zerolog.ErrorLevel
	FatalLevel = zerolog.FatalLevel
	PanicLevel = zerolog.PanicLevel
	NoLevel    = zerolog.NoLevel
	Disabled   = zerolog.Disabled
)

Functions

func Attach

func Attach(kvs ...string)

func Ctx

func Ctx(ctx context.Context) *zerolog.Logger

func Debug

func Debug() *zerolog.Event

func DebugEnable added in v1.9.0

func DebugEnable() bool

func Error

func Error() *zerolog.Event

func Fatal

func Fatal() *zerolog.Event

func Info

func Info() *zerolog.Event

func Log

func Log() *zerolog.Event

func Logger

func Logger() zerolog.Logger

func NewConsoleWriter

func NewConsoleWriter() io.Writer

func NewFileWriter

func NewFileWriter(c FileWriterConfig) io.Writer

func Panic

func Panic() *zerolog.Event

func SetLogger

func SetLogger(l zerolog.Logger)

func Trace

func Trace() *zerolog.Event

func Warn

func Warn() *zerolog.Event

func With

func With() zerolog.Context

func WithLevel

func WithLevel(level zerolog.Level) *zerolog.Event

Types

type FileWriterConfig

type FileWriterConfig struct {
	Filename   string
	MaxSize    int
	MaxAge     int
	MaxBackups int
}

type L added in v1.4.1

type L = zerolog.Logger

type Level added in v1.9.0

type Level = zerolog.Level

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L